Kilojoules to gigawatt-hour Conversion
1 kilojoules (kJ) is equal to 0.0000000002777777778 gigawatt-hour (GW⋅hr).
1 kJ = 0.0000000002777777778 GW⋅hr
or
1 GW⋅hr = 3600000000 kJ
Formula
To convert a energy from kilojoules (kJ) to gigawatt-hour (GW⋅hr), divide the energy in kilojoules by 3600000000
e(GW⋅hr) = e(kJ) / 3600000000
Examples:
Convert 500 kilojoules to gigawatt-hour:
e(GW⋅hr) = 500kJ / 3600000000 = 0.0000001388888889 GW⋅hr
